Docker下载工具应用
在软件开发的过程中,我们经常需要使用各种工具来帮助我们完成开发任务。而在使用这些工具的过程中,有时候我们会遇到一些依赖问题或者版本冲突,这时候我们就需要使用 Docker 来隔离这些工具的环境,确保它们不会影响到我们的开发环境。本文将介绍如何使用 Docker 来下载和运行工具应用,并提供一些常用的示例代码。
Docker 简介
Docker 是一个开源的容器化平台,可以帮助开发者打包应用和其所有的依赖项成为一个独立的容器。这个容器可以在任何环境中运行,而不用担心依赖问题。通过 Docker,我们可以更加方便地下载和运行各种工具应用。
下载 Docker
首先,我们需要在本地电脑上安装 Docker。Docker 官网提供了各种不同平台的安装包和安装说明,我们可以根据自己的操作系统选择合适的安装包进行安装。
# 下载并安装 Docker
# Ubuntu 系统
sudo apt-get install docker
# CentOS 系统
sudo yum install docker
# MacOS 系统
brew install docker
下载工具应用
接下来,我们可以使用 Docker 来下载和运行工具应用。以下载并运行一个简单的 Python 工具为例:
Python 工具示例
# 下载并运行 Python 工具
docker run -it --rm python:latest
通过上述命令,我们可以下载并运行最新版本的 Python 工具,而不用担心与本地 Python 环境的冲突。
序列图示例
下面我们来看一个使用 Docker 下载和运行工具应用的序列图示例:
sequenceDiagram
participant User
participant Docker
participant Tool
User->>Docker: 请求下载工具应用
Docker->>Tool: 下载工具应用
Docker->>User: 返回下载结果
饼状图示例
接下来,我们看一个使用 Docker 下载和运行工具应用的饼状图示例:
pie
title 工具应用下载比例
"Python" : 40
"Java" : 30
"Node.js" : 20
"其他" : 10
结语
通过本文的介绍,我们了解了如何使用 Docker 来下载和运行工具应用,并提供了一些常用的示例代码。使用 Docker 可以帮助我们隔离工具应用的环境,确保它们不会影响到我们的开发环境。希望本文对大家有所帮助,谢谢阅读!